Rebuilding Your Spiritual Home: A Message of Hope

Losing a home can be a devastating experience, leaving you feeling lost and uncertain about the future. However, as Christians, we believe that even in the midst of chaos and uncertainty, God is working to bring about good. In Isaiah 58:11, we read, "The Lord will guide you always; he will satisfy your needs in a sun-scorched land and will strengthen your frame. You will be like a well-watered garden, like a spring whose waters never fail." This verse offers us a powerful reminder that even in the midst of loss, God is still in control and is working to bring about restoration.

Finding Hope in the Midst of Loss

When we lose our home, it can be tempting to feel hopeless and defeated. However, as Christians, we have grounds for optimism. We know that God is sovereign and that He is working to bring about good, even in the midst of our suffering. As the verse in Isaiah reminds us, God will guide us always and satisfy our needs. This is a powerful comfort, especially when we are facing uncertainty and hardship. We can trust that God is working to bring about restoration, and that He will give us the strength and resources we need to rebuild our lives.
